Does Linux have more vulnerabilities than Windows?

Reasonably close behind was Android on 2,563 vulnerabilities, with the Linux kernel in third place having racked up a count of 2,357. As for Microsoft’s operating systems, Windows 7 bore 1,283 vulnerabilities, and Windows 10 carried 1,111.

Is Linux more secure than Windows or Mac?

Many experts have said that Linux is much safer to use than Windows or MacOS because of its low usage compared to its competitors. Also, Linux doesn’t provide users with admin access by default, limiting the damage that users can do by clicking on links.

How to compare the security of windows and Linux?

Managers need a framework to evaluate operating system security that includes an assessment of base security, network security and protocols, application security, deployment and operations, assurance, trusted computing, and open standards. In this study, we compare Microsoft Windows and Linux security across these seven categories.

Which is more vulnerable windows or macOS or Linux?

So the Windows operating system does not come with some inherent flaws that make it more vulnerable than other platforms. It’s just that malicious hackers will try to target Windows over Linux or macOS because of the higher probability of successful attacks, just because of the attack surface and the number of users.

Which is more secure windows or Mac OS?

If one looks at issues of vulnerabilities in Mac, Windows or Linux or really any operating system, it’s very similar. Because building an operating system is a very hard task, and therefore, all of them have similar kinds of vulnerabilities. So technically Mac is not particularly more secure than Windows.
